Mariska: We Needed a Performance Like This, and I Can't Explain It
Chelsea manager Enzo Mariska appeared in a press statement after the victory over Tottenham Hotspur 1-0 in the tenth round of the Premier League.
The coach said: "It was a good match, no doubt. Against this team, in this stadium, and at this time when they are performing strongly, we needed a performance like this."
He added: "I think you need to be brave whether with the ball or without it. We defended excellently without the ball, but we also created chances when we had it. Winning makes us very happy, for us and for the fans, because it’s a big derby."
Regarding the difference between the defeat against Sunderland and the victory over Tottenham: "I can't explain it, because I don't have the answer. When I don’t know something, it's better to say I don’t know. When we become more stable, we can get closer to the top."
On Moisés Caicedo's performance: "He is a top-class player. Right now, he and Rodri are the best defensive midfielders in the world."
He added: "Especially in England, leading 1-0 does not mean the match is over. Anything can happen. We could have scored another goal or two, and it would have been more comfortable, but we are happy with the 1-0 win and keeping a clean sheet."
About Wesley Fofana: "Wes is a great defender. Before the match, we were one of the highest scoring teams, but our problem was conceding too many. We need to be more solid if we want to compete for the top positions."
He concluded about the calmness after the defeat against Sunderland: "That’s the first thing I told the players after that match. We moved from 11th to 4th after this win. We need to maintain balance. After the Sunderland match, many said there was a problem, and of course, we have things to improve, but we are on the right track."
